LENS · GOVERN

Govern traffic & usage.

Full control over every AI request your company makes; policy, budget, sovereignty, and PII handling evaluated inline before the model sees the payload. Start here if the job is making AI usage accountable and keeping regulated data where it belongs.

RelayOne policy + sovereignty RelayGate programmable middleware

How it composes: RelayOne enforces origin, destination, residency, and spend across four distinct surfaces (sovereignty, employee AI access, network reroute, identity + commerce); the same guarantees hold on-prem, sovereign, hybrid, or cloud, without a cloud-provider audit dependency. RelayGate is the binary that sits between your agent and the model provider; ContextWorkers run inline inside the request for credential injection, PII stripping, and policy, not in a queue hidden behind a gateway.

LENS · TRUST

Trust, research, transact.

Ground every answer in evidence, verify every output against a spec, and settle every commercial event on a signed chain. Start here if the job is making AI output safe to show a customer, or safe to hand to a regulator.

DeepTap knowledge engine Veritize verification + drift TrueCom commerce substrate

How it composes: DeepTap grounds agent answers with a compounding Fact Cache; three depth modes, a seven-layer retrieval pipeline, MCP and A2A protocols, ZDR by default. Veritize verifies that the output actually uses the evidence; structured evaluators first, LLM evaluators last, drift tracked across model and prompt versions. TrueCom signs the commercial event; six primitives, ten settlement rails, seven dispute states, one call shape. The rail is an argument, not a rebuild.
